Directions for Use
Thoroughly clean threaded surfaces prior to application.
Knead tube well (for best results, remove cap, squeeze out air, place cap back on tightly, then knead well).
Apply paste evenly and fill threads completely. Carefully assemble and tighten the threaded joint.
Close cap tightly after use.
Joint is ready for immediate use.
GTS® paste can be certified to meet many nuclear specifications because of its purity and thermal stability. Supplied in a form that permits easy application, GTS® paste is an ideal replacement for Teflon® thread sealant tape and other conventional thread sealant materials in critical high temperature and high-pressure service applications.
Each lot of GTS® paste is packaged in 125 gm nuclear grade polyethylene “squeezable” tubes to protect against contamination.
The purity level of GTS® paste allows it to meet the stringent certification requirements of the nuclear power generation industry such as the General Electric nonmetallic material specification D50YP12 Rev 2.
GTS® paste can also be used as an effective bolt lubricant or anti-seize compound, having outperformed conventional lubricants under tests. Because GTS® paste does not harden or cure with time or temperature, joints sealed with GTS® paste will be easy to dissemble even after years of high-temperature service.
